I have spectre ii and element 2, both have ss baffles. Ive been doing the dip, but even after 4 hours the stuff is still hard as heck. Yes i just about use hazmat gear to deal with the dip and have the used stuff in sealed containers. After 4 hour soak i still had to scrape the hell out of the element baffles. Guess i need a much longer soak! The tubes clean up so easy compared to the baffles. How do you clean them? If you use the dip, how long do you soak? Need some other good ideas.
